maxresdefault.jpgHistory and development:
On-line poker surfaced inside belated 1990s as a consequence of breakthroughs in technology together with internet. 1st on-line poker room, Planet Poker, was released in 1998, attracting a small but passionate community. But was at the first 2000s that on-line poker practiced exponential growth, mostly due to the intro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.
